How much do human resources intern j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 9, 2026, the average hourly pay for human resources intern in Rutherford, NJ is $17.64,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$14.71 and $19.62 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Human Resources Intern vs HR Assistant?

AspectHuman Resources InternHR Assistant
Required CredentialsUsually pursuing or recently completed a degree in HR, Business, or related fieldTypically requires some HR coursework or entry-level experience
Work EnvironmentInternship setting, often part-time or temporary, in HR departmentsFull-time, ongoing support role within HR teams
Employer & Industry UsageCommon in corporate, nonprofit, and government sectors for training and developmentStandard entry-level role across various industries for HR support

In summary, a Human Resources Intern is usually a student or recent graduate gaining initial exposure to HR functions, often in a temporary or part-time capacity. An HR Assistant is a more permanent, full-time role requiring some foundational HR knowledge, providing ongoing support within the HR department.

What does a human resources intern do?

A Human Resources Intern supports the HR department with a variety of tasks such as assisting in recruitment, maintaining employee records, helping organize company events, and processing paperwork. They often help screen resumes, schedule interviews, and onboard new employees. HR interns also gain exposure to company policies, employee relations, and HR software. The internship is designed to provide hands-on experience and a foundational understanding of HR practices within an organization.

What does a human resources intern do?

A human resources intern works in a company’s human resources (HR) department. Interns can fulfill many roles in the HR department and work directly under the supervision of a manager. An HR intern’s duties may include posting jobs, reviewing resumes, conducting interviews, and assisting with salary negotiation. HR interns are often students or recent graduates who are gaining work experience to build their resume. Internships may also provide academic credit or pay.

What types of projects or tasks can a human resources intern expect to work on during their internship?

As a Human Resources Intern, you can expect to be involved in a variety of tasks that provide exposure to core HR functions. These may include assisting with recruitment processes (such as screening resumes and scheduling interviews), maintaining employee records, supporting onboarding activities, and helping to organize company events or training sessions. Interns often collaborate closely with HR team members and other departments, gaining hands-on experience with HR software and participating in meetings. This role offers a great opportunity to develop foundational HR skills while contributing to meaningful projects within the organization.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a human resources intern,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Human Resources Intern, you need a basic understanding of HR principles, strong organizational skills, and ideally be enrolled in or have completed a relevant degree such as Human Resources, Business Administration, or Psychology. Familiarity with HR information systems (HRIS), Microsoft Office Suite, and basic data management tools is typically required. Excellent communication, attention to detail, and a proactive attitude are standout soft skills in this role. These abilities are important for supporting HR functions efficiently, ensuring accuracy, and fostering a positive workplace environment.

Overview

The incumbent will be responsible for assisting with the Attendance, Benefits and Payroll functions, as well as the Employee Morale Enhancement Program.

Responsibilities

Include but are not limited to

  • Assist the Attendance & Payroll team to process daily attendance administration and coordinate with departments for timesheet adjustment
  • Paid Time Off entitlement preparation for new hires and terminated employees for payroll processing
  • Assist the Benefits team with processing benefits enrollment, termination, changes and preparing benefits orientation package
  • Assist the department with office administration
  • Participate in special projects and/or other duties as assignments
Qualifications
  • Bachelor's degree required, ideally in Human Resources, Organizational Development, Labor Relations, or other related majors; Master's degree preferred
  • 0-2 years of HR related experience with strong interest and passion in HR as a career required
  • Be capable of multi-tasking and working in fast-paced environment
  • Excellent communication skills in verbal and writing is a must, bilingual ability in Mandarin is highly preferred
